For our inaugural episode we talked to Dr. Kristen Weiss, a researcher at the University of California, Santa Barbara, and the communications coordinator for the Long-Term Ecological Research Network, or LTER. We talked to her about her career path from marine research to science communication, about the challenges of climate change from a communications perspective, and about how to become a better science communicator.
